While immediacy guides the evolution of the virtual infrastructure we inhabit on a daily basis, it's important to highlight the weight that lies beneath the illusion of digital instantaneity. We therefore practice a form of dilated, anti-spectacular temporality, which exposes - through slow weaving - properties of the digital body that are obstructed by the acceleration of media exchanges.  

This particular performative approach gives rise to a flexible relationship with the audience. We do not seek to impose a specific experience, but rather to create a fertile, intimate and contemplative space, encouraging a diversity of types of aesthetic engagement. This is how "Murs de chair" takes shape: not as an authoritarian manifesto preaching the anamnesis of the digital body, but rather as a call to think differently about the virtual entities that populate our shared spaces.
